SCUBA DIVING

Scuba diving in Queensland has strict medical requirements. Certain medical conditions (including but not limited to asthma, heart conditions, diabetes, or the use of prescription medication) may prevent participation in diving activities. 

Some passengers may be required to obtain medical clearance from a doctor prior to diving. Please note that medical clearance must meet recognised diving medical standards and may be declined if it is deemed insufficient or not appropriate for scuba diving. 

Participation in diving activities is subject to approval by our qualified dive instructors, and final decisions are made with safety as the highest priority.
